Since it's a DD I would sleeve it for piece of mind but I have a couple friends running 600whp+ on stock Kseries blocks. There's a guy on k20a his car made 740/490wtq and its beat on night and day and it's his daily he just made 822/550wtq on stock sleeves and it's been running hard for a year+ (and it's on eagle rods). Considering your budget I would drop 1k on sleeves in a heartbeat and get someone who knows what they're doing to assemble it. ERL, Golden Eagle etc.

Yep, I called Golden Eagle yesterday to get a quote..$910 for the sleeves and decking, $125 for final bore and hone (with pistons sent with it), and $85 for shipping, should have the money next month..Once again this is going to be a prolonged build so there is no rush..lots of time for decisions..just wanna get a decent plan down before I start buying stuff.

Now the question of 83mm or 84mm sleeves?

And pistons should I go with the JE with Crower rod combo I posted? Or CP, or Wiseco..etc.?

Ill need to figure out the pistons before I can send the block out to GE so this would be my #1 step.
